The Crenshaw Rams Youth Football & Cheerleading programs (formerly known as the Crenshaw Colts) have been established with the Snoop Youth Football League (SYFL) since 2008. Our athletic programs are provided to boys and girls ages 5-13 and provide coaching and training to help them excel in the sport while creating options to obtain college scholarships.
The Crenshaw Rams Story
The Crenshaw Rams began as a Snoop Youth Football League team in 2008; as the Crenshaw Colts under the direction on the team's President, Andre Carter. Mr. Carter and his team brought an undeniable passion to help young athletes succeed in the game, and most importantly, in the classroom.
After his unfortunate passing in 2012, the team retired the 'Colts' name in memory of Carter and rebranded the program as the Crenshaw Rams in 2016. The debut season football season under the new team name was led by the team's Commissioner (Eugene "Big U" Henley), President (Nicole), Athlete Services Coordinator (Leesha); as well as Cheer Coordinators Stacy and Joi.
